KVM: selftests: Move setting a vCPU's entry point to a dedicated API
Extract the code to set a vCPU's entry point out of vm_arch_vcpu_add() and
into a new API, vcpu_arch_set_entry_point(). Providing a separate API
will allow creating a KVM selftests hardness that can handle tests that
use different entry points for sub-tests, whereas *requiring* the entry
point to be specified at vCPU creation makes it difficult to create a
generic harness, e.g. the boilerplate setup/teardown can't easily create
and destroy the VM and vCPUs.
